The Significance of Chicken Coop Mesh Wire A Comprehensive Guide
When it comes to raising chickens, creating a safe and secure environment for your flock is paramount. One of the crucial components of this setup is the chicken coop mesh wire. Choosing the right mesh wire is critical for the safety, health, and happiness of your chickens, and understanding its various types, benefits, and installation techniques can make all the difference in your poultry-keeping experience.
What is Chicken Coop Mesh Wire?
Chicken coop mesh wire, often referred to as chicken wire or poultry netting, is a type of fencing made from thin wire strands twisted together to form a mesh pattern. It is designed to keep chickens contained within a designated area while also providing adequate ventilation and protection from predators. Mesh wire typically comes in various sizes and gauge thicknesses, allowing owners to select the appropriate type based on their specific needs and circumstances.
Types of Chicken Coop Mesh Wire
There are several types of mesh wire available for chicken coops
1. Hexagonal Wire Netting This is the traditional choice for chicken coops. The hexagonal shape offers good visibility and ventilation, and it is sturdy enough to withstand minor impacts. However, it may not be suitable for very small chicks, as they can slip through the gaps.
2. Welded Wire Fencing Welded wire is a more robust option, where the wires are welded at intersections to provide extra strength. This type of mesh can deter larger predators such as foxes or raccoons, making it an excellent choice for those living in rural areas. It also comes in various heights and gauge thicknesses.
3. Electric Fencing For serious predator protection, electric fencing can be combined with traditional mesh wire. This option can deter not only land predators but also aerial threats, as chickens are vulnerable to hawks and other birds of prey.
4. Plastic Poultry Netting A lighter, often less expensive option, plastic netting can be effective for temporary enclosures or for keeping chickens contained in a backyard setting. However, it may not be as durable as metal options and could be more susceptible to damage from animals.
Benefits of Using Chicken Coop Mesh Wire
Using the right mesh wire in your chicken coop offers a multitude of benefits
- Protection from Predators One of the most significant advantages is safeguarding your chickens from predators
. A well-installed mesh wire can prevent raccoons, foxes, hawks, and other wildlife from accessing your flock.- Good Ventilation A properly designed chicken coop incorporates mesh wire, which allows for air circulation while keeping chickens safe from external threats. This ventilation is vital for maintaining a healthy environment.
- Visible Environment Mesh wire products allow for easy visibility, letting you monitor the health and behavior of your chickens without intrusion.
- Longevity and Durability Investing in high-quality mesh wire can lead to long-term savings, as a robust barrier will last for years, reducing the need for frequent replacements.
Installation Tips
When installing chicken coop mesh wire, consider the following guidelines for effective use
1. Choose the Right Size Ensure the gauge and mesh size are appropriate for the breed of chickens you have. Smaller breeds may need tighter mesh to prevent escape.
2. Secure Installation Attach the mesh wire firmly to the coop and any posts or supports to avoid sagging or collapses over time.
3. Bury the Bottom To prevent digging predators, bury a portion of the wire underground or extend it outward to create a flap barrier.
4. Regular Maintenance Periodically check the integrity of the wire and make necessary repairs to keep your flock safe.
